geminiGeminiTurn 1

I agree with Claude and ChatGPT on the strong presence of 6sense, Demandbase, Terminus, and RollWorks as core ABM players. However, let's be accurate. ChatGPT's pick of Engagio is outdated; Engagio was acquired and is now fully integrated into Demandbase One. It simply doesn't exist as a standalone platform anymore, which is a critical oversight.

Claude, while ZoomInfo Marketing is excellent for data and prospecting, it's not a comprehensive ABM orchestration platform in the same vein as 6sense or Demandbase. It's a powerful data source for ABM, but not a full-suite solution for intent, engagement, and cross-channel campaign management.

My list maintains Salesforce Account Engagement (Pardot) at number five. For any business already on Salesforce, Pardot offers unparalleled native integration, robust marketing automation, and strong account-level personalization capabilities. It leverages existing CRM data for highly effective, integrated ABM campaigns, providing a complete picture within a single ecosystem.

claudeClaudeTurn 1

I see strong convergence on the top tier, but let me address the differences.

Agreement: 6sense, Demandbase, and Terminus clearly belong in the top 5. All three of us recognize these as category leaders. 6sense's AI-driven intent data is unmatched, Demandbase One offers the most comprehensive ABM platform, and Terminus excels at multi-channel orchestration.

Challenges:

Engagio (ChatGPT's #4): This is outdated. Engagio was acquired by Demandbase in 2020 and no longer exists as a standalone product. It's now part of Demandbase One. This shouldn't be a separate entry.

Pardot (Gemini's #5): While Salesforce Account Engagement has ABM features, it's fundamentally a marketing automation platform, not a purpose-built ABM solution. It lacks the account-level intelligence and orchestration that defines true ABM platforms.

RollWorks deserves its spot — strong ROI for mid-market, excellent integration with Salesforce, and solid account identification.

ZoomInfo Marketing merges best-in-class B2B data with ABM capabilities, making it more powerful than Pardot for actual account-based strategies.
